Description

The Revised NEO Personality Inventory: Clinical and Research Applications serves as a practical handbook for clinicians across all disciplines. This volume is designed to help readers build basic competency in applying and interpreting the NEO PI-R within both clinical and research settings. As one of the most frequently used assessment instruments in the field of personality assessment, the NEO PI-R provides a reliable method for understanding individual differences. This guide focuses on the unique capabilities of the NEO PI-R, which stands as the only commercially available measure built to operationalize the constructs of the five-factor model of personality (FFM). Whether you are working in a research lab or a clinical practice, this book provides the foundational knowledge needed to use this comprehensive assessment tool effectively. It is an essential resource for professionals seeking to master the application of the five-factor model in their daily work.
